Our mission : support European craftspeople in the digital transition, enhance European Cultural Heritage professions as an asset for European social cohesion, economic development 

Company short introduction.  Mad’in Europe is a small company based in Brussels supporting European professions in cultural Heritage (restoration-conservation, fine and traditional crafts) as an asset for European Economy, Culture and Identity.  Our aim is to use innovative tools and solutions to bring growth and to position these professions as a valid option and business opportunity for next generations. Our main actions are:

  • Connect European professionals in fine/traditional crafts and restorers of cultural heritage with an international audience of private consumers, architects, retailers, designers, interior designers, historic houses owners, and other professionals.  
  • Raise awareness among the public about the value of crafts in culture, economy, and society.
  • Support transmission of know-how, capacity building and mobility in the sector.
  • Participate to European projects (Erasmus+, Horizon, Creative Europe, Interreg…) with other European partners to valorise the crafts sector, develop and disseminate best practices, and coach crafts professionals in the innovation, digital and environmental transition.
  • Develop a large network of collaborations with other European stakeholders (New European Bauhaus, Historic Houses associations, Foundations, Architects, members of the World Crafts Council Europe and the Heritage Alliance 3.3, European, Commission) to develop synergies, merge resources and get fundings.
